Environment + Sustainability
35% emissions reduction
Net-zero greenhouse gas target
Aims to reduce absolute Scope 1 and 2 emissions by 35% by 2030, aligned with the Science Based Targets initiative (SBTi).
15% emissions reduction
Early achievement of interim target
Reduced operational greenhouse gas emissions by 15% as of 2023, meeting the 2025 interim target two years early.
40% material recovery increase
Resource recovery goal
Aims to increase the recovery of key materials by 40% by 2030, supporting circularity and resource efficiency.
50% biogas reuse increase
Biogas beneficial reuse target
Committed to increasing biogas sent to beneficial reuse by 50% by 2030, enhancing renewable energy generation.
  • Open five new renewable natural gas plants; renewable-energy portfolio includes 86 projects
  • Deploy collision-avoidance cameras on collection trucks (2,200+ units)
  • Pace electrification: goal for 50% of new refuse vehicle purchases to be EVs by 2028
  • Initiatives include landfill-gas-to-energy, polymer center for plastics circularity, recycling and organics programs
  • Employee engagement goal: maintain ≥ 88% by 2030 (supports sustainability culture)
Inclusion & Diversity
50% Ethnically Diverse Workforce
Diverse Workforce Representation
Half of the company's workforce is composed of ethnically diverse individuals, reflecting a commitment to inclusivity.
38% Leadership Roles by Women
Women in Top Leadership
38% of top leadership positions within the company are held by women, showcasing progress toward gender equality.
$75.8M with Diverse Suppliers
Diverse Supplier Spending
The company spent $75.8 million with certified diverse suppliers in 2022, aiming for $150 million by 2025.
82% Employee Satisfaction
Employee Satisfaction Rating
82% of employees rated the company as a great place to work in a 2024 survey, reflecting a supportive workplace culture.
  • Established MOSAIC Council in 2013 to drive inclusion efforts, including recruiting partnerships, training, leadership development, and business resource group support.
  • Removed college-degree requirements for many roles to broaden access and inclusivity.
  • Aims to achieve 50% diversity in leadership roles by 2030.
